0
    SEVERE: CDI Beans module deployment failed
    org.apache.webbeans.exception.WebBeansDeploymentException: Error while sending SystemEvent to a CDI Extension! org.apache.webbeans.portable.events.discovery.AfterDeploymentValidationImpl@4cc26df
        at org.apache.webbeans.event.NotificationManager.onWebBeansException(NotificationManager.java:1075)
        at org.apache.webbeans.event.NotificationManager.doFireSync(NotificationManager.java:1026)
        at org.apache.webbeans.event.NotificationManager.doFireEvent(NotificationManager.java:952)
        at org.apache.webbeans.event.NotificationManager.fireEvent(NotificationManager.java:928)
        at org.apache.webbeans.container.BeanManagerImpl.fireEvent(BeanManagerImpl.java:495)
        at org.apache.webbeans.container.BeanManagerImpl.fireLifecycleEvent(BeanManagerImpl.java:490)
        at org.apache.webbeans.config.BeansDeployer.fireAfterDeploymentValidationEvent(BeansDeployer.java:900)
        at org.apache.webbeans.config.BeansDeployer.deploy(BeansDeployer.java:386)'
Caused by: org.apache.webbeans.exception.WebBeansException: java.lang.IllegalStateException: No ConfigProviderResolver implementation found!
    at org.apache.webbeans.event.ObserverMethodImpl.notify(ObserverMethodImpl.java:377)
    at org.apache.webbeans.event.NotificationManager.invokeObserverMethod(NotificationManager.java:1146)
    at org.apache.webbeans.event.NotificationManager.doFireSync(NotificationManager.java:1009)
    ... 59 more
Caused by: java.lang.IllegalStateException: No ConfigProviderResolver implementation found!
    at org.eclipse.microprofile.config.spi.ConfigProviderResolver.loadSpi(ConfigProviderResolver.java:138)
    at org.eclipse.microprofile.config.spi.ConfigProviderResolver.instance(ConfigProviderResolver.java:124)
    at org.eclipse.microprofile.config.ConfigProvider.getConfig(ConfigProvider.java:85)
    at org.apache.tomee.microprofile.health.MicroProfileHealthReporterProducer.reporter(MicroProfileHealthReporterProducer.java:38)

==============================================================================

Other error in log

Caused by: org.apache.openejb.OpenEJBRuntimeException: org.apache.webbeans.exception.WebBeansDeploymentException: Error while sending SystemEvent to a CDI Extension! org.apache.webbeans.portable.events.discovery.AfterDeploymentValidationImpl@4cc26df
    at org.apache.openejb.cdi.OpenEJBLifecycle.startApplication(OpenEJBLifecycle.java:200)
    at org.apache.openejb.cdi.ThreadSingletonServiceImpl.initialize(ThreadSingletonServiceImpl.java:260)
    ... 51 more
Caused by: org.apache.webbeans.exception.WebBeansDeploymentException: Error while sending SystemEvent to a CDI Extension! org.apache.webbeans.portable.events.discovery.AfterDeploymentValidationImpl@4cc26df
    at org.apache.webbeans.event.NotificationManager.onWebBeansException(NotificationManager.java:1075)
    at org.apache.webbeans.event.NotificationManager.doFireSync(NotificationManager.java:1026)
    at org.apache.webbeans.event.NotificationManager.doFireEvent(NotificationManager.java:952)
    at org.apache.webbeans.event.NotificationManager.fireEvent(NotificationManager.java:928)
    at org.apache.webbeans.container.BeanManagerImpl.fireEvent(BeanManagerImpl.java:495)
    at org.apache.webbeans.container.BeanManagerImpl.fireLifecycleEvent(BeanManagerImpl.java:490)
    at org.apache.webbeans.config.BeansDeployer.fireAfterDeploymentValidationEvent(BeansDeployer.java:900)
    at org.apache.webbeans.config.BeansDeployer.deploy(BeansDeployer.java:386)
    at org.apache.openejb.cdi.OpenEJBLifecycle.startApplication(OpenEJBLifecycle.java:196)
    ... 52 more
Caused by: org.apache.webbeans.exception.WebBeansException: java.lang.IllegalStateException: No ConfigProviderResolver implementation found!
    at org.apache.webbeans.event.ObserverMethodImpl.notify(ObserverMethodImpl.java:377)
    at org.apache.webbeans.event.NotificationManager.invokeObserverMethod(NotificationManager.java:1146)
    at org.apache.webbeans.event.NotificationManager.doFireSync(NotificationManager.java:1009)
    ... 59 more
Caused by: java.lang.IllegalStateException: No ConfigProviderResolver implementation found!
    at org.eclipse.microprofile.config.spi.ConfigProviderResolver.loadSpi(ConfigProviderResolver.java:138)
    at org.eclipse.microprofile.config.spi.ConfigProviderResolver.instance(ConfigProviderResolver.java:124)
    at org.eclipse.microprofile.config.ConfigProvider.getConfig(ConfigProvider.java:85)
    at org.apache.tomee.microprofile.health.MicroProfileHealthReporterProducer.reporter(MicroProfileHealthReporterProducer.java:38)

when Checked with tomee team they are saying this can be related to the Microprofile config impl shifting from geronimo to smallrye https://issues.apache.org/jira/browse/TOMEE-4184 but if the jar's are already in class path dont know why we see this No ConfigProviderResolver implementation found! error

0 Answers0